About this conference
One of the largest open source technology conferences in the United States. The 2026 edition moves to two focused days in downtown Raleigh: Monday for immersive learning and community experiences, Tuesday for keynotes and 30-minute sessions across 20 tracks, with AI-assisted development featured heavily. Co-located community activities run Sunday, October 18.
